Abstract
A display device having a plurality of gate lines and a gate drive circuit is disclosed. The gate drive circuit includes a pull-up transistor configured to receive a first clock signal and to charge an output node to a voltage of the first clock signal based on a voltage of a Q node. The output node is connected to a corresponding one of the gate lines. The gate drive circuit also includes a switching circuit configured to charge the Q node based on a second clock signal. The switching circuit has an inverter circuit configured to control the voltage of the Q node based on the second clock signal.
